Recovery and Rehabilitation: Timeline and Expectations for Pelosis Physical Well-being
Recovery and Rehabilitation
Pelosi is expected to undergo physical therapy and rehabilitation to regain her mobility and strength. The recovery timeline for hip replacement surgery varies depending on the individual, but typically involves:
Immediate Post-Surgery: Pain management, wound care, and early mobilization with assistance.
Week 1-6: Progressive weight-bearing, walking with a walker or crutches, and gentle range-of-motion exercises.
Month 2-6: Gradual increase in weight-bearing, stair climbing, and balance exercises.
Month 6-12: Return to most activities, including driving and work, as tolerated.
Expectations for Physical Well-being
Recovery from hip replacement surgery can be challenging, but with proper care and follow-up, most patients can expect to:
Reduced pain and stiffness: The new joint should significantly reduce the pain and discomfort experienced before surgery.
Improved mobility: The surgery aims to restore or improve range of motion and overall mobility.
* Enhanced quality of life: A successful hip replacement can lead to improved sleep, increased physical activity, and a better overall quality of life.
